Golden Entertainment Forms Strategic Partnership After Revenue Decline

Golden Entertainment, a leading gaming company based in Las Vegas, recently announced the launch of a new partnership intended to strengthen its presence within the competitive gaming market. The initiative is part of the company’s strategic efforts to diversify and amplify its offerings amid evolving consumer trends.
Despite this positive development, the firm disclosed a notable year-over-year decrease in revenues deriving from ongoing operations. Industry analysts attribute this decline primarily to the lack of Super Bowl-related business, which traditionally generates significant gaming activity and revenue spikes for operators in the sector.
The gaming industry remains sensitive to major sporting events, and the diminished Super Bowl turnover has underscored inherent vulnerabilities. Experts suggest that Golden Entertainment’s partnership represents a proactive response aiming to mitigate future risks while tapping into new opportunities across diversified markets.
According to market observers, such strategic collaborations are crucial for gaming companies to maintain competitive advantage and sustain growth, especially within the fluctuating landscape of entertainment and sports betting.
